For grid-connected systems, the first consideration is to establish if you want a central string inverter, a string inverter with component optimizers, or a micro-inverter system. String inverters usually cost 10% to 20% much less than optimizer or micro-inverter systems. They have a 15 to 20 year anticipated performance life. String inverter warranties generally cover ten years, and most suppliers supply optional extensive service warranties approximately two decades.

Photovoltaic panel can be likewise tilt-mounted on flat roofing systems using attachments or non-penetrating ballast trays for all kinds of flat roof covering surface areas. There are a few variants of ground-mounted photovoltaic panels. The most common is a multi-pole ground place making use of numerous concrete piers and 2" or 3" galvanized steel posts.
There are additionally single-pole ground places that can fit as lots of as 16 photovoltaic panels on solitary 6", 8" or 10" pole.
